Historical Good Friday Procession

In a program of intense Easter liturgy, in Gualdo Tadino the rites of the holy week are characterized in manifestations of high religious content, among which the Historical Procession of Good Friday is distinguished. An imposing procession that recalls the Passion of Jesus according to the medieval tradition handed down by the Company of Santa Maria dei Raccomandati, whose members, with the various city confraternities, proceeded two by two singing poetic compositions of religious theme and popular character which the city kept a precious collection.
On this dramatic base this grandiose and spectacular representation took shape, from the church of San Francesco, where the simulacrum of the Dead Christ is kept, they proceed through the city streets to the sound of the "battistrangola" (ancient musical instrument that has almost completely disappeared) representing, with two hundred and fifty characters divided into fourteen paintings, the significant episodes of the Via Crucis, or the traditional sequence of the historical drama of the Passion, from capture to the trial, from the ascent to the ordeal to the crucifixion of Jesus.
Significantly, the procession closes with the simulacrum of the dead Christ carried by the Confraternity of the Holy Trinity, the statue of Our Lady of Sorrows and the faithful.
The dramaticness of this re-enactment, even in its simplicity, reaches very high tones with the scene of the crucifixion in the great square, for the intense collective participation and for the suggestive context offered by the historical center.

It takes place on Good Friday.
